Port Chester Pizza Shop Burglarized

$500, computer stolen in break-in.

A laptop computer and $500 cash were reported stolen in a burglary at a Port Chester pizza shop.

Police said someone smashed a hole into the wall near a rear entrance to , 130 Midland Avenue and was able to gain entrance to the shop. The shop closed at about 10:30 p.m. Saturday and the burglary was discovered when the shop opened at 9:30 a.m. on Sunday.

A bag for the laptop computer was also taken in the theft. Port Chester police said the buglary is under investigation and no arrests have been made yet in connection with this incident.
